#de9695 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#de9695 is composed of 87.1% red, 58.8%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 32.4% magenta, 32.9%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 0.8 degrees, a saturation of 52.5% and a lightness of 72.7%. #de9695 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bd2d2b.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

Shades and Tints of #de9695
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0404 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.
